Rescuing Human Rights from Proportionality

The principle of proportionality has enjoyed extraordinary success over the last decades: it has become a staple of international and constitutional adjudication on fundamental rights; it has been espoused by civil and common law judges alike, and described as the “principle of principles” and the “ultimate rule of law”. But what does proportionality mean for the idea of human rights?

Conference Outcome: The Future Role of the ECHR

The Freedom Rights Project, in cooperation with the iCourts Centre of Excellence, recently co-hosted an international conference on the Future Role of the European Court of Human Rights. The conference featured a highly esteemed panel of legal professionals, academics and political representatives, including several national and European judges.

The mission of the Freedom Rights Project is to advocate for fundamental human rights that secure civil and political liberties. We monitor and analyze global trends that have diluted and weakened the concept of human rights.
